Seaworld is the first brand in Phu Quoc to be licensed to trade in various types of marine entertainment services. Currently, Seaworld owns a 1-hectare Coral Park, with around 200 species of hard and soft corals, more than 100 species of natural sea fish, precious marine creatures, and 9,000 square meters of a restored protected area.
In the presence of the leader of Kien Giang Provincial People’s Committee, representatives of departments, local authorities, and guests, the Vietnam Record Organization has awarded Phu Quoc Coral Park with the title of the first Coral Park in Vietnam to appreciate Seaworld’s efforts to create marine space and regenerate marine ecosystems in the ceremony on January 3rd, 2020.
